Acute Recovery Gel
Hydrating wound-support gel for professional management of suitable acute wounds and superficial burns.
A hydrating topical gel formulated to support a moist wound environment in suitable acute wounds and superficial burns. The formula concept combines a hypertonic polyol system with PHMB, EDTA, panthenol, low-molecular-weight hyaluronic acid and allantoin. Intended for professional or professionally supervised wound-care use.
Professional assessment is recommended before use on open wounds. Final regulatory classification determines professional-use requirements by market.
How it works
Modern wound care aims to maintain controlled moisture, protect viable tissue and reduce factors that delay healing. Acute Recovery Gel is designed to hydrate the wound surface, support autolytic cleansing and improve contact between the wound and an appropriate secondary dressing.
The PHMB–EDTA system is included for antimicrobial and biofilm-management positioning. Because antimicrobial wound claims may classify the product as a medical device or medicinal product in some markets, final website language must match the approved product dossier, microbiological validation and local registration.

Formula components
| Component | Declared range | Purpose |
|---|---|---|
| Hypertonic Polyol Complex (Glycerol + Sorbitol) | 40–50% | Moisture control, osmotic effect and gel hydration. |
| Panthenol | 5% | Hydration and soothing support. |
| Allantoin | 0.3% | Soothing and skin-conditioning support. |
| Low-molecular-weight Hyaluronic Acid | 0.1–0.2% | Moisture retention and wound-bed hydration. |
| PHMB (Polyhexanide) | 0.1% | Antimicrobial wound-care component; requires validated claim support. |
| EDTA | 0.05–0.1% | Chelating support and biofilm-oriented formulation strategy. |
| Target pH | 4.2–4.8 | Acidic wound-environment positioning, subject to final stability data. |
Directions for use
- Clean the wound according to the healthcare professional's protocol.
- Apply a thin, even layer directly to the suitable wound area or to the selected dressing.
- Cover with an appropriate sterile secondary dressing where required.
- Reapply one to two times daily or at each dressing change, depending on exudate level and professional instructions.
- Do not insert deeply into body cavities or use on severe burns without specialist supervision.
Clinical & safety precautions
- Professional assessment is recommended before use on open wounds.
- Do not use in patients with known sensitivity to PHMB, polyhexanide or any component.
- Do not use in the eyes, middle or inner ear, central nervous system tissue, or other sites where PHMB is contraindicated.
- Seek urgent medical care for deep wounds, heavy bleeding, spreading redness, fever, severe pain, black tissue, electrical or chemical burns, or suspected infection.
- Do not combine with incompatible wound cleansers or anionic surfactants unless compatibility has been established.
- Single-patient use is recommended unless the packaging and applicator system are specifically validated for multi-patient clinical use.
